草庐IT

iphone - 添加 FaceBook Connect 时架构 i386 的 undefined symbol

当我在iPhone5.1模拟器上运行我的应用程序时,我有以下失败代码。在我将FacebookConnect添加到我的应用程序之前,我的应用程序运行平稳。Undefinedsymbolsforarchitecturei386:"_FBCreateNonRetainingArray",referencedfrom:-[FBSessioninitWithKey:secret:getSessionProxy:]inFBSession.old:symbol(s)notfoundforarchitecturei386clang:error:linkercommandfailedwithexitco

ios - 找不到体系结构 i386 错误 iOS 的符号

我的代码本身没有错误,但是当我尝试运行时,我得到了这个错误-Symbol(s)notfoundforarchitecturei386erroriOS。我寻找答案,但到目前为止没有任何帮助。我确定我正在链接到正确的库。此外,代码在不同的项目中单独运行时确实有效。本质上,我制作了一个应用程序的各个部分,但在让它们一起工作时遇到了这个问题。这两个应用程序之间的一切都是相同的。唯一真正的区别是我将它与coreplot代码一起运行,所以我不确定这是否与它有任何关系?错误是由于TFHipple元素而发生的。这是错误的副本:Ld/Users/jyurcho/Library/Developer/Xco

ios - COCOAPODS 验证 i386 错误

我正在尝试使用我的代码以及一些外部库和依赖项为iOS创建我自己的POD。附带的示例使用XCODE正确编译和构建应用程序。但是当我要验证时:$>podliblint--allow-warnings--verbose--no-clean我得到这个错误的代码。这似乎是与该方案相关的架构问题,但我没有运气找出设置中的错误。**BUILDFAILED**Thefollowingbuildcommandsfailed:Ld/Users/marcsu/Library/Developer/Xcode/DerivedData/App-eszacdypuufiakgbloohgxurnwhy/Build/

ios - "Undefined symbols for architecture i386"问题

我们有一个android/ios应用程序,到目前为止在Xcode中构建正常。星期一我们将Xcode升级到版本6.1.1。从那时起,我无法在Xcode模拟器中构建和运行我们的应用程序。ld:warning:ignoringfile/Users/ACCOUNTZ/Library/Developer/Xcode/DerivedData/Accountz-crbaoextdggovrahxqcivilxfgeh/Build/Products/Debug-iphonesimulator/libCordova.a,filewasbuiltforarchivewhichisnotthearchite

ios - 架构 i386 的 undefined symbol : "_OBJC_CLASS_$_Facebook", 从 : objc-class-ref in AppDelegate. o 引用

我不知道为什么会出现这个错误。我已经导入了facebookiossdk静态库,但出现了该错误。可能是什么原因造成的?谢谢大家的帮助架构i386的undefinedsymbol:“_OBJC_CLASS_$_Facebook”,引用自:AppDelegate.o中的objc-class-refld:未找到架构i386的符号clang:错误:链接器命令失败,退出代码为1(使用-v查看调用)Undefinedsymbolsforarchitecturei386:"_OBJC_CLASS_$_Facebook",referencedfrom:objc-class-refinAppDelegat

ios - 标题不丢失时在 xcode 中出现错误 "Undefined symbols for architecture i386"

当我尝试编译我的iPhone应用程序并在模拟器中运行它时,我收到错误,提示undefinedsymbol。所有这些符号都对应于我的项目中包含且未丢失的类。例子:"_OBJC_CLASS_$_SHKFacebook",referencedfrom:objc-class-refinFooAppDelegate.oobjc-class-refinFooLandingPageViewController.oobjc-class-refinFooAppDelegate.o但是项目中并没有缺少SHKFacebook.h。有什么想法吗?谢谢! 最佳答案

iOS 制作通用库 - 适用于 i386 和 arm7

我们正在构建一个用于iOS开发的库。我们可以为模拟器生成一个i386库,或者为硬件设备生成一个arm7库。就像现在一样,在将库分发给我们的其他开发人员时,我们需要有两个不同的文件(.a库)。这对于分发目的来说有点麻烦。我想知道;有没有一种方法可以在XCode中构建库,以便单个.a库文件同时包含i386和arm7,这样我们就可以为i386和arm7这两种架构分发一个库文件。 最佳答案 您可以使用lipo工具将这两个文件拼接成一个“通用”文件:lipo-create.a.a-outputlib.a

iphone - 架构 i386 的重复符号错误

我在尝试构建时遇到了这个错误:“重复符号__Z8ERRCHECK11FMOD_RESULT:/Users/codemenmini2012-2/Library/Developer/Xcode/DerivedData/MagicSleepFullVersion-agxulkdijnxbqmbuigucmrczufyw/Build/Intermediates/MagicSleepFullVersion.build/Debug-iphonesimulator/MagicSleepFullVersion.build/Objects-normal/i386/MagicSleepViewContro

ios - 架构 i386 : "_OBJC_CLASS_$_ZipException", 的 undefined symbol 引用自:错误

我在我的项目中使用了一些“.o”文件,并且在编译时显示以下错误,error:linkercommandfailedwithexitcode1(use-vtoseeinvocation)我已经在下面发布了错误日志Ld/Users/deepak/Library/Developer/Xcode/DerivedData/app-bnwpvhpbrfdurbdgxucyddqyfosh/Build/Products/Debug-iphonesimulator/app.app/appnormali386cd/Users/deepak/Workspace/iosDevelopement/PROJEC

ios - podspec 警告 : no rule to process file for architecture i386

我的Podspec是这样的:s.resource='JOBaseSDK/Resources/**/*.{png,txt}'当终端中的pod规范lint时我会收到警告注意|警告:没有规则来处理架构i386的文本类型文件“JOProjectBaseSDK/JOBaseSDK/Resources/111.txt”注意|警告:没有规则来处理架构x86_64的文本类型文件“JOProjectBaseSDK/JOBaseSDK/Resources/111.txt”谁能帮我解决一下?谢谢! 最佳答案 为资源文件定义似乎没问题。你能检查一下扩展名为